From: James Simmons Date: Sat, 8 Apr 2017 16:52:15 +0000 (-0400) Subject: LU-9019 quota : migrate to 64 bit time X-Git-Tag: 2.9.56~25 X-Git-Url: https://git.whamcloud.com/?p=fs%2Flustre-release.git;a=commitdiff_plain;h=2e2c8d59cfdb6d7078f9627ca970920059fcf90f LU-9019 quota : migrate to 64 bit time Replace cfs_time_current_sec() to avoid the overflow issues in 2038 with ktime_get_real_seconds(). The quota uses the libcfs 64 bit time abstraction it developed before the linux kernel has created its own. Replace all the libcfs 64 bit time handle with generic time64_t handling.
